Moral Idealism

A philosophical stance emphasizing the importance of moral principles and ideals in determining individual behavior and guiding societal norms.

Political Realism

A theory in international relations that emphasizes the competitive and conflictual side of international politics, where states act primarily in their own interests.

American Isolationism

American isolationism is a foreign policy stance whereby the United States seeks to avoid involvement in international alliances and issues, focusing instead on domestic prosperity and security.

Mutual Alliance Pact

An agreement between two or more nations to support each other in case of war or conflict.
